Chapter 8: X Resources and the Graphical Interface

Resource setting - general procedure

Application specific resources
If you plan to modify an application-specific resource, you should look in the
HP64_Debug file for information about that resource.
If the RESOURCE_MANAGER property exists (as is the case with
HP VUE), copy the complete HP64_Debug file, or just the part you are
interested in, to a temporary file. Modify the resource in your temporary file
and save the file. Then, merge the temporary file into the
RESOURCE_MANAGER property with the xrdb -merge < filename>
command.
If the RESOURCE_MANAGER property does not exist, copy the complete
HP64_Debug file, or just the part you are interested in, to your .Xdefaults file.
Modify the resource in your .Xdefaults file and save the file.
Finally, if the debugger's graphical interface is currently executing, you must
exit and restart the interface for the change to have any effect.
General resources
If you plan to modify a general resource that could not be found in the
HP64_Debug file, look to the scheme files for information about that
resource. A general discussion of the kinds of information found in the
scheme files can be found in the previous "Scheme files augment other
resources" section.
Copy the appropriate scheme file to one of the alternative directories and
make the modifications there. (If you are using $XAPPLRESDIR, make sure
the variable is set and exported.) Save the file. If the debugger's graphical
interface is currently executing, you must exit the application and restart it to
see the results of your change.
